SOFIA (Bulgaria), September 12 (SeeNews) - ICGB, the project company developing the Gas Interconnector Greece-Bulgaria (ICGB) said on Tuesday it plans to launch several tender procedures for the construction of the pipeline by the end of the year.
"The company is in the process of preparation of the respective procedures for assigning the main contracts which are necessary for the start of the construction - selection of owner's engineer for the project; line pipe supplies; assigning of the detailed engineering, procurement and construction (EPC contract); archaeological research and selection of the construction supervision company," Sofia-registered ICGB said in a statement.
On September 1, ICGB submitted an application for a construction permit for the Bulgarian part of the pipeline. The permit is expected to be issued by the regional development ministry in the first half of September 2017.
